We have a breathtaking PAIR of Victorian Cranberry Wine Glasses which date to around 1890.
The workmanship in the glass is of the highest quality and it is definitely English.
Unmarked but by one of the top glass cutters of the time such as Walsh or Stevens and Williams. they have Cranberry Bucket Bowls which have been hexagonally cut to clear.
The stems have been finely notch cut and they stand on star cut feet. English lead. no chips. cracks or restoration.
They measure 5 inches tall with 2 5/8 inch bowls and 2 ¾ inch feet.
